Vue.js is among the world’s most popular language frameworks for applications and interface development. Its relative lightweight platform, ease of understanding, simple integration, and flexibility have given it huge support from developers and organizations such as Alibaba, Xiaomi and others.
This course from KnowledgeHut has been designed to give you a bird’s eye view of how Vue.js can be used to create single page apps or server side rendered apps. Our experiential course will help you learn about instances, single page apps and mixins, routing and other concepts needed to build state of the art applications. As front end applications get more and more sophisticated the need for Vue.js experts is on the rise. This is your chance to get started on a great career.
Learn the basics of Vue.js, including its use of templates to display data on a page
Learn to set up Vue projects from scratch, or use vue-cli to set up from a template
Understand the fundamental concepts of Vue.js and how to use it in applications
Learn to create instances, learn about single page apps, Custom directives, Mixins, Routing and more
Discover how Vue.js works with CSS to style your websites and applications
Use render functions and JSX, rather than templates, to determine what Vue displays
Be able to control how code is executed and displayed with vue-router
Learn to effectively use and navigate the Vuex library
Build a fully functional app from scratch, and unit test your applications
365 Days FREE Access to 100 e-Learning courses when you buy any course from us
Interact with instructors in real-time— listen, learn, question and apply. Our instructors are industry experts and deliver hands-on learning.
Our courseware is always current and updated with the latest tech advancements. Stay globally relevant and empower yourself with the latest tools and training.
Learn theory backed by practical case studies, exercises and coding practice. Get skills and knowledge that can be effectively applied in the real world.
Learn from the best in the field. Our mentors are all experienced professionals in the fields they teach.
Learn concepts from scratch, and advance your learning through step-by-step guidance on tools and techniques.
Get reviews and feedback on your final projects from professional developers.
Learning Objective:
By the end of this module you will learn what kind of problems vue.js will solve and how to setup and run a vue app.
Hands-on:
Create new vue app using vue cli, execute and debug.
Learning Objective:
By the end of this module you will learn about the templating syntax and its abilities.
Hands-on:
Create a vue app which explores the template syntax features like interpolation, directives, expressions, watchers, filters, computed properties, iterative & conditional rendering.
Learning Objective:
By the end of this module you will gain deeper understanding about vue instance, lifecycle and data access from vue instance.
Hands-on:
Create a vue application that creates multiple vue instances, explore through the lifecycle methods and code data access from outside vue instance
Learning Objective:
By the end of this module you will learn how to work with events in vue.
Hands-on:
Create a vue app that responds to events.
Learning Objective:
By the end of this module you will learn how to develop forms and the power of 2 way binding.
Hands-on:
Create forms and apply two way binding to read and write data to forms.
Learning Objective:
By the end of this module you learn about the significance of components and their power in reusability. You will also learn how to decompose a given web page into individual components and how to compose them to make them represent a page.
Hands-on:
Convert a single html web page into a series of components, register components and compose components into application.
Learning Objective:
By the end of this module you will learn how to enable communication between components.
Hands-on:
Create multiple components and enable communication between independent component props for parent to child communication, events for child to parent and non parent child components using event emitter.
Learning Objective:
By the end of this module you will learn how to embed arbitrary content inside of child components.
Hands-on:
Create a reusable component which accepts arbitrary content using slots.
Learning Objective:
By the end of this module you will learn how to switch between various arbitrary components at the same mount point using dynamic components.
Hands-on:
Create a component with tabbed layout that switches components between tabs dynamically.
Learning Objective:
By the end of this module you will learn how to develop a custom directive beside the built in directives.
Hands-on:
Create a custom directive that modifies the background colour of the element when the directive is applied.
Learning Objective:
By the end of this module you will learn a flexible way to distribute reusable functionalities for Vue components using mixins.
Hands-on:
Create a mixin and apply to components.
Learning Objective:
By the end of this module you will learn how to format data in vue template without altering the original value using filters.
Hands-on:
Create a component that uses default filters to format data in template, also chain multiple filters.
Learning Objective:
By the end of this module you will learn how to consume remote apis in vue applications.
Hands-on:
Create components that fetch data from remote api and post data to remote api.
Learning Objective:
By the end of this module you will learn how to power vue application with routing. Also learn how to protect routes using guards.
Hands-on:
Setup and configure vue-router, create navigation component and code declarative routing using router links, code imperative routing from component methods, configure route parameters and read them from inside component. Protect routes using guards.
Learning Objective:
By the end of this module you will learn how to take the advantage of state management, how to setup vue app with vuex.
Hands-on:
Create a centralized store, getter & setters, actions
Learning Objective:
By the end of this module you will learn how to apply mutation to change state in a Vuex store.
Hands-on:
Create mutations to change the data in the store
Learning Objective:
By the end of this module you will learn the basics of unit testing vue app.
Hands-on:
Create simple unit test to test components.
The rise in the demand for front end developers means that you need to be aware of all the latest technologies that are trending right now in this space. Vue.js is one of them.
Vue.js gives us the best of both Angular and React. In fact many consider it to be a significant improvement to its predecessor Angular without the added complexity, and having extra flexibility and modularity. Vue.js is now a very popular framework to build powerful single page web apps. This course will teach you all about Vue.js and help you in getting started with the technology to build your own apps.
You will:
By the end of the course, you will have:
There are no restrictions but participants are expected to have basic HTML, CSS and JavaScript knowledge.
Yes, KnowledgeHut offers this training online.
On successful completion of the course you will receive a course completion certificate issued by KnowledgeHut.
Your instructors are Web development experts who have years of industry experience.
Any registration cancelled within 48 hours of the initial registration will be refunded in FULL (please note that all cancellations will incur a 5% deduction in the refunded amount due to transactional costs applicable while refunding) Refunds will be processed within 30 days of receipt of written request for refund. Kindly go through our Refund Policy for more details: http://www.knowledgehut.com/refund
KnowledgeHut offers a 100% money back guarantee if the candidate withdraws from the course right after the first session. To learn more about the 100% refund policy, visit our Refund Policy.
In an online classroom, students can log in at the scheduled time to a live learning environment which is led by an instructor. You can interact, communicate, view and discuss presentations, and engage with learning resources while working in groups, all in an online setting. Our instructors use an extensive set of collaboration tools and techniques which improves your online training experience.
Once you register for the course you will be provided with system requirements and lab setup document which contains detailed information to prepare the environment for the course
I would like to thank the KnowledgeHut team for the overall experience. My trainer was fantastic. Trainers at KnowledgeHut are well experienced and really helpful. They completed the syllabus on time, and also helped me with real world examples.
The course which I took from Knowledgehut was very useful and helped me to achieve my goal. The course was designed with advanced concepts and the tasks during the course given by the trainer helped me to step up in my career. I loved the way the technical and sales team handled everything. The course I took is worth the money.
The skills I gained from KnowledgeHut's training session has helped me become a better manager. I learned not just technical skills but even people skills. I must say the course helped in my overall development. Thank you KnowledgeHut.
I am glad to have attended KnowledgeHut's training program. Really I should thank my friend for referring me here. I was impressed with the trainer who explained advanced concepts thoroughly and with relevant examples. Everything was well organized. I would definitely refer some of their courses to my peers as well.
Everything from the course structure to the trainer and training venue was excellent. The curriculum was extensive and gave me a full understanding of the topic. This training has been a very good investment for me.
Overall, the training session at KnowledgeHut was a great experience. I learnt many things. I especially appreciate the fact that KnowledgeHut offers so many modes of learning and I was able to choose what suited me best. My trainer covered all the topics with live examples. I'm glad that I invested in this training.
I would like to extend my appreciation for the support given throughout the training. My special thanks to the trainer for his dedication, and leading us through a difficult topic. KnowledgeHut is a great place to learn the skills that are coveted in the industry.
I would like to extend my appreciation for the support given throughout the training. My trainer was very knowledgeable and I liked his practical way of teaching. The hands-on sessions helped us understand the concepts thoroughly. Thanks to Knowledgehut.
Hyderabad, the city of the erstwhile Nawabs of India is all set to get a booster shot to its IT sector. The Information Technology Investment Region or ITIR is an area which is currently under development jointly by the central and state government. The aim is to evolve knowledge clusters to bolster growth of IT and electronic hardware industries which would be spread around 50,000 acres in and around the city. This mammoth project is expected to attract investments totaling to about $44 billion and is expected to offer employment to nearly 1.5 million people. To feature in Hyderabad?s booster shot one needs to be updated with the latest skill-sets of the industry. Make the journey a little easier and enrol with the VUE JS online training & certification course in Hyderabad provided by Knowledgehut institute
Vue.js is an open-source framework powered by JavaScript to build user interfaces and single-page applications. Amongst everything, application programming improvement is a standout in most large corporations and companies. The online program offered by Knowledgehut institute enables you to operate the framework just like in the real world. With simulations designed to prepare you for any challenges, the nearly 100 hours of mock MCQs and assignments are curated to offer you a holistic view of the framework. The course will enable you to empower yourself with the latest tools and techniques regarding the Vue.js framework. Take a look for yourself by signing up for a quick demo to find out more about the cost, schedule and availability of our VUE JS certification in Hyderabad.
If you are aspiring to make a mark as a front-end web application developer and looking to upgrade your skill-set, then the VUE JS course in Hyderabadis just the one for you. With a vast course which is always being updated with the latest techniques and 24 hours of live sessions, this coaching is the most effective when it comes to learning about the usage of Vue.js framework. With the online lecturesappend your CV with knowledge that will help you gain an upper hand as compared to your peers. By building an application from scratch learn about the best practices to application building leveraging the Vue.js framework.
With a theory-based learning culture backed by hands-on practice sessions, get to know the various nuances of the Vue.js framework. Interact with our coaches who are leaders in their fields and are highly experienced in teaching developers the tricks of the trade. In conclusion, the VUE JS course in Hyderabad will help you gain a different perspective to application building.
So what are you waiting for? Register for the VUE JS online training course in Hyderabad now!